What Does Web Scraping Mean?

There’s a lot details on the internet, with new info continuously being included. You’ll in all probability be interested in some of that data, and much of it really is in existence for your using.

Sign up for us and get entry to Many tutorials, hands-on movie programs, and a Group of qualified Pythonistas:

Another fairly well known category of web scrapers is predicated on browser extensions. These scrapers run instantly inside your World wide web browser occasion and make total use of your respective browser engine and its integrated Website technologies (the DOM, CSS kinds and selectors, and jogging JavaScript).

Longevity: Web sites frequently change. Say you’ve built a shiny new Internet scraper that instantly cherry-picks what you wish from the resource of desire.

ScrapingBee's black box tactic ensures that all the proxy and community management is looked after from the System as well as the person only desires to provide the specified website addresses, together with the applicable ask for parameters.

As someone, any time you take a look at an internet site through your browser, you deliver what’s identified as an HTTP request. This is basically the electronic equal of knocking to the doorway, asking to come in.

But no problems, as you’re working with Python strings so that you can .strip() the superfluous whitespace. You may also utilize another acquainted Python string ways to additional clean up your textual content:

ScrapeBox positions by itself largely for Website positioning use, but it could be equally helpful for bulk scraping of YouTube and for general content scraping.

Scraping Road blocks - is the website you ought to scrape employing any stability layers to block crawlers and scrapers? Will you might want to remedy CAPTCHAs? Do you want to take into account fee restrictions? Do you should send out the ask for from a specific spot - Or perhaps even must rotate networks?

, then you’ll see a completely new Web Scraping webpage that contains extra in-depth descriptions of the job on that card. You might also recognize the URL as part of your browser’s handle bar changes whenever you navigate to a kind of web pages.

Requests-HTML is a challenge established because of the writer of the Requests library that helps you to render JavaScript working with syntax that’s much like the syntax in Requests. Additionally, it incorporates capabilities for parsing the info through the use of Stunning Soup underneath the hood.

However, once you endeavor to print the data of the filtered Python Employment such as you’ve performed right before, you operate into an error:

Play around and investigate! The more you receive to find out the site you’re dealing with, the a lot easier it’ll be to scrape. But don’t get too overwhelmed with everything HTML textual content. You’ll use the power of programming to step via this maze and cherry-select the knowledge that’s suitable for you.

You can find procedures that some websites use to stop World wide web scraping, for instance detecting and disallowing bots from crawling (viewing) their internet pages.

1 2 3 4 5 6 7 8 9 10 11 12 13 14 15

Comments on “What Does Web Scraping Mean?”

Leave a Reply

Gravatar